Key Maintenance for Your 2022 Hyundai Elantra

These are the service intervals most commonly required for your vehicle. Each one should be documented with a receipt or timestamped photo.

Recommended service intervals

Engine Oil and Filter Change
7,500 miles or 12 months
Tire Rotation
Every 5,000-7,500 miles
Brake Inspection
Every 20,000-30,000 miles
Air Filter Replacement
Every 30,000-45,000 miles
Cabin Air Filter Replacement
Every 15,000-20,000 miles
Spark Plug Replacement
Every 60,000-100,000 miles
Transmission Fluid Service
Every 60,000-90,000 miles
Coolant Flush
Every 60,000 miles or 5 years
